Quick-N-Easy Garlicky Trail Mix

(gluten free & paleo)

Prep time: 5 minutes Cook time: 10-15 minutes Yield: 8

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up raw organic cashews

  • 1 cup raw organic almonds

  • 1 cup coconut chips

  • 1 cup golden raisins

  • ¼ cup avocado oil (plus more if needed to coat the mixture)

  • 1 tsp. garlic granules

  • ½-1 tsp. fresh cracked black pepper

  • ½ tsp. Pink Himalayan sea salt

How to Create this Recipe:

  1. Preheat oven to 400 ° F.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

  2. In a large mason jar add all the ingredients BUT the raisins, secure the lid, and get to shakin’!! (You can also do this in a big bowl and stir it)

  3. Once mixed thoroughly, transfer the mix to the parchment lined baking sheet and toast in the oven for 10-15 minutes, or until toasty and golden brown looking.

  4. Once cooled a bit, add the mix back to the mason jar, add the raisins, give it another shake or two. That’s all!! 

  5. Enjoy!!

 

NUTRITION

Servings: 1 (based off of 8 servings total)


Calories: 312

Fat: 15 g

Carbs: 23 g

Protein: 3 g


*All nutritional information are estimations and will vary.
